A reminder that paper proposals are due February 12, 2017 for the Fourth International Meeting on Experimental and Behavioral Social Sciences (IMEBESS) at Universitat de Barcelona on 27-29 April 2017.

We are very fortunate to have a fantastic roster of key-note guest speakers this year: Sarah Brosnan (Georgia State University), Laura Fortunato (University of Oxford), Rebecca Morton (NYU), and Roberto Weber (University of Zurich).

The conference is locally organised by Jordi Muñoz Mendoza, Albert Falcó-Gimeno, and Roberto Pannico, with support of the POLEXP network, in collaboration with Jordi Brandts (Institut d’Anàlisi Econòmica (CSIC) and Barcelona GSE), Raymond Duch (Nuffield College Oxford University), Enrique Fatás (University of East Anglia), and Diego Gambetta (European University Institute).

Both theoretical and empirical papers on the topics in all areas of the social sciences, such as experimental and behavioural economics, sociology, political science, psychology are encouraged. Authors will receive notification of acceptance on 29 February 2017.

 Further information and instructions for submissions are available on the conference web site:
